Quick conversion table
| degree Celsius | degree Rankine |
|---|---|
| -40 °C | 419.67 °R |
| 0 °C | 491.67 °R |
| 10 °C | 509.67 °R |
| 20 °C | 527.67 °R |
| 25 °C | 536.67 °R |
| 37 °C | 558.27 °R |
| 50 °C | 581.67 °R |
| 100 °C | 671.67 °R |
Unit definitions
degree Celsius (°C)
degree Celsius is a unit of Temperature. In this converter it is defined against the category base unit as base = value × 1 + 273.15.
degree Rankine (°R)
degree Rankine is a unit of Temperature. In this converter it is defined against the category base unit as base = value × 0.555555555556 + 0.
